About the Role
This is a 12-month fixed-term contract with the potential for the role to become permanent for the right candidate. Reporting to a Finance Manager, you will be a key member of the finance team supporting commercial and operational activities through financial analysis, reporting, and forecasting.
About You
- Qualified Accountant (ACA, ACCA, CIMA or equivalent) with at least 2 years of experience
- Experience working within a complex, cost-driven environment
- Strong analytical skills with the ability to interpret financial and operational data
- Advanced Excel skills, including modelling and scenario analysis
- Experience working with large data sets and complex data analysis
What You'll Do
- Analyse customer profitability, product margins, and overall performance to support strategic initiatives
- Monitor and evaluate costs of sales and operational expenses, assessing their impact on margins and profitability
- Provide financial insights for pricing strategies and new product development
- Prepare monthly reports and develop forecasting models for short and long-term planning
- Ensure regulatory compliance, support audits, and assess market or regulatory changes
- Collaborate with business teams to improve financial outcomes and present insights to senior leadership

How to prepare for a job interview at VANRATH
β¨Know Your Numbers
As an Accountant, you'll need to demonstrate your financial acumen. Brush up on key financial metrics relevant to the role, such as profitability ratios and cost analysis. Be ready to discuss how you've used these in past roles to drive strategic decisions.
β¨Excel Skills on Display
Since advanced Excel skills are a must, prepare to showcase your proficiency. Bring examples of complex models or analyses you've created. If possible, practice explaining your thought process behind these tools, as it shows your analytical capabilities.
β¨Understand the Company Culture
This organisation values innovation and community engagement. Research their recent projects or initiatives that align with these values. During the interview, mention how your personal values and experiences resonate with their culture, showing you're a great fit for their team.
β¨Prepare Insightful Questions
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are thoughtful questions about the company's financial strategies or how they measure success in their finance team. This not only shows your interest but also your strategic thinking, which is crucial for the role.
